FBI declares man wanted for drug trafficking

The suspect is wanted for his alleged involvement in drug activities in Minneapolis, Minnesota.

The U.S.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) has declared a man, Fronta Lontrell Miller, wanted for drug trafficking.

The FBI, in a statement on Tuesday, declared Mr Miller wanted and urged the public to provide information that could lead to his arrest.

“Fronta Lontrell Miller is wanted for his alleged involvement in drug activities in Minneapolis, Minnesota, from in or about June 2022 through in or about June 2026,” the FBI said.

“On June 26, 2026, a federal arrest warrant was issued for Miller in the United States District Court, District of Minnesota, Minneapolis, Minnesota,” it added.

The warrant issued for the arrest of Mr Miller came after he was charged with conspiracy to distribute controlled substances.
